Three-Milk Cake Recipe: The Secret Behind Tres Leches Softness

By Aditi

February 1, 2026

Tres leches cake is light, airy, and dipped in a rich three-milk mixture. It is a classic dessert that appears to be fancy but can be prepared with simple pantry ingredients.

Ingredients

For the Cake 1 cup all-purpose flour 1 tsp baking powder ¼ tsp salt 5 large eggs (separated) 1 cup sugar (¾ cup + ¼ cup) ⅓ cup milk 1 tsp vanilla extract For the Milk Soak 1 cup full-fat milk ½ cup sweetened condensed milk ½ cup evaporated milk For Topping 1 cup whipping cream 2 tbsp powdered sugar ½ tsp vanilla extract

Step 1

Preheat the oven to 180°C. In a mixing bowl, whisk flour, baking powder, and salt together. Keep them aside so that the batter remains light and lump-free.

Step 2

Beat egg yolks with ¾ cup sugar until pale in colour and thick. Mix in milk and vanilla to make a smooth, rich yellow base.

Step 3

Separately, whip egg whites until soft peaks form. Now, slowly add the remaining sugar and beat until it turns glossy.

Step 4

Add the egg whites to the yolk mixture. Now, add the dry ingredients in small batches carefully to maintain the airy and spongy texture.

Step 5

In a greased pan, bake for about 25 to 30 minutes. Check by inserting the toothpick; if it comes out clean, it is baked. Let the cake cool down a bit, then poke holes all over it.

Step 6

Lastly, mix all three milks and pour slowly over the cake. Keep it in the refrigerator for about 3–4 hours, then top with whipped cream before slicing and serving.